Tudor Investment Corp ET AL Trims Stock Position in Preferred Bank (NASDAQ:PFBC)

Preferred Bank logo with Finance background

Tudor Investment Corp ET AL lessened its holdings in Preferred Bank (NASDAQ:PFBC - Free Report) by 41.3% during the fourth qu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und owned 6,724 shares of the bank's stock after selling 4,732 shares during the period. Tudor Investment Corp ET AL's holdings in Preferred Bank were worth $581,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Preferred Bank Profile

(Free Report)

Preferred Bank provides various commercial banking products and services to small and mid-sized businesses and their owners, entrepreneurs, real estate developers and investors, professionals, and high net worth individuals. The company accepts checking, savings, and money market deposit accounts; fixed-rate and fixed maturity retail, and non-retail certificates of deposit; and individual retirement accounts.
